    I am looking at one of my brick walls well in fact most of the afternoon and I am not having any luck.

    I am looking for my Uncles wife you would think with a name like Minnie Amelia Emma Southgate she would be easy to find. I have the marriage certificate they married (Ernest Richard Cox) in 1937 in District of Shoreditch, she states her father is George William Southgate Deceased, Labourer. Witness name's do not help, one is another uncle of mine and another is a George Watson, I have found Minnie living with George's family on the Electoral roll it looks like he was a neighbour. I know they moved to Northampton they lived there until they died.

    On the death details it states Minnie's DOB is 4 Oct 1908 and Ernie's is 18 Oct 1906, it was these dates I thought would help me find them on the 1939 register but no luck there.

    I would love to find her birth Certificate but had no luck finding her registered details. I have worked on the assumption that she has lied about her status as a spinster on the MC, and looked for a previous marriage for her, but no luck there. I searched using just her christian names a few came up and I looked at those but they did not work.

    Can anyone think of anything I have not done to enable me to find her birth certificate?

    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ated.

        I was going to suggest that you try different combinations of the various forenames you have for her, during her life.
        When I began this lark over 30 years ago, I naively thought that everything "written down" in authorised records would be "right." I could never find a birth or marriage registration for great aunt May. When I eventually got to read 1891 census, I discovered that she was named Sarah Ann, after her mother, but obviously was referred to in the family as "May" (the month of her birth) to distinguish her from her mother. She married as Sarah May, was known to her husband and children as May and was buried as plain May.
